just like if you sow a sapling and take good care of it, it grows into a healthy tree and provides you with fruits so that you can reap benefits, the same way whatever you do now will affect your future. it can also be said as karma. if you do good you will be able to reap the goodness in the coming age and if you set a trap for someone you will be paid back when the time is right. it means that man is responsible for the effect of his actions. if he does good only goodness will churn out in the long run.
